Abstract
It is known that orbital angular momentum (OAM) couples the Goos-Hanchen and Imbert-Fedorov shifts. Here, we present the first study of these shifts when the OAM-endowed LG(l,p) beams have higher-order radial mode index (p>0). We show theoretically and experimentally that the angular shifts are enhanced by p while the positional shifts are not. Since LG(l,p) modes form a complete basis set for paraxial beams, our results can be used to predict beam shifts of arbitrary modes of light.
